As our Pharmacy Buyer, you will coordinate the timely and accurate inventory of pharmacy and IV supplies. Every day you will manage procurement, maintain optimal stock levels, support barcoding, act as an ordering expert, ensure regulatory documentation, and optimize cost efficiency within the pharmacy operating system. To be successful in this role, you will meticulously manage inventory, ensure compliance, maintain a safe environment, and proactively stay updated on departmental policies and accreditations.

Coordinate all pharmaceutical ordering for the Pharmacy Department
Coordinate any applicable centralized purchasing of high cost, low use or nominally priced items
Procure emergency supplies
Review back order lists and procure merchandise from alternate vendor
Review and approve orders along with the Regional Procurement Manager
Coordinate centralized procurement of medications that are in short supply
Meet inventory turn rate goals
Oversee all regional electronic pharmacy purchasing and troubleshoot electronic purchasing issues
Maintain the electronic database including maintenance and update of 340B issues
Act as the primary point of contact with the carousel database vendor
Train and mentor the Pharmacy employees responsible for purchasing
Train new Pharmacy employees on the Carousel system
Act as a subject matter expert to resolve all technical electronic ordering questions
Provide guidance to the Pharmacy employees in reference to recalls and to addressing the lack of availability of certain products
Maintain current contract files
Prepare and submit all billing documents
Compile usage figures
Responsible for the timely reconciliation and maintenance of any loans or borrows
Unpack, price, and rotate the medication stock received and oversee the stocking of the pharmacy department
Ensure all items received are matched against department request sheet
Track specific product line purchases
Resolve discrepancies with wholesaler representatives
Communicate with designated pharmacy personnel, buying group representatives and wholesaler representatives
